When irrigating a patient's ear in which direction should the irrigating solution be directed?

When irrigating a patient's ear, the irrigating solution should be directed toward the posterior superior canal to help dislodge any debris or wax. This means the solution should flow upward and backward, avoiding direct pressure on the tympanic membrane. It's essential to maintain a gentle flow to prevent discomfort or injury to the ear.
